LATEST: After the scandal in Philly, Provorov and Tortorella are taking a lot of heat because of their response
A scandal occurred last night in Philadelphia when Flyers defenseman Ivan Provorov refused to take part in the warm-up due to the fact that they were wearing the pride night jerseys.
The responses were coming from everywhere and the media coverage of the occurrence exploded because of the sensibility behind the event. The Flyers issued a statement and the team's head coach met the media regarding the matter, here's what he had to say:
